The map collection of the State Library is the best publicly accessible collection of maps and atlases available in Perth. It is available on the first floor of the State Library. The collection holds maps from all the Australian state mapping agencies. It is rich in early maps from the United Kingdom which is useful for genealogists. The collection includes current travel maps of countries and major cities around the world, especially south-east Asia. Western Australian maps are collected and held in the JS Battye Library of Western Australian History on the 3rd floor of the State Library.

Australian Topographic Maps: 1:100,000 and
1:250,000
The State Library holds the complete
set of 1:100,000 and 1:250,000 topographic maps of Australia produced
by Geoscience Australia. To find the map number for the area
that you are interested in, check the correct gazetteer
first:
- 1:100,000 Master names file [microform] : [Australia 1:250 000 and 1:100 000 master names gazetteer - Australian Surveying and Land Information Group (1st Fl, Map Shelves, 2750)
- 1:250,000 Australia 1:250,000 map series : gazetteer - prepared by the Division of National Mapping, Department of Minerals and Energy (1st Fl, Map Shelves, 2750)
